Rapid Structural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can handle a small sp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ly and dry the area thoroughly.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es A burst pipe can cause significant water damage, and it's best to call a professional to assess and repair the damage.
Mold growth in a small area No Yes Mold growth can spread quickly, and it's best to call a professional to assess and treat the affected area.
Water damage from a flooded basement No Yes A flooded basement can cause significant damage, and it's best to call a professional to assess and repair the damage.
High humidity levels in a small area No Yes High humidity levels can lead to mold growth and further damage, and it's best to call a professional to assess and reduce humidity levels.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Ocean Township, NJ

The cost of Rapid Structural Drying can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ocean Township, NJ.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of time required to dry the area.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 - $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of treatment required.
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 - $10,000 The extent of the damage and the type of repairs required.
